Train Derails, Strange Smells: Wilmington Police Log For March 8

Here are some of the calls Wilmington Police responded to Thursday.

WILMINGTON, MA -- The following are items recorded by Wilmington Police Department. It is a sample of the types of calls the Wilmington Police responded to on Thursday, March 8, 2018 An arrest does not indicate a conviction. And all suspects are considered innocent until proven guilty in a court of law.

Wilmington Police responded to dozens of calls of downed limbs, low-hanging and fallen wires, and down trees Thursday as a result of the storm.

1:10 am: Assisting Fire Department with report of strange odor on Beeching Road. Fire Department cut power to house where odor was reported. Wires still in roadway.

1:17 am: Assist Fire Department with reports of strange odor on Lake Street. Possibly related to power surge in area.

1:20 am: Odor of smoke on Lake Street. Fire Department handling.

5:00 am: Jeep backed into parked car at Heavenly Donuts on Main Street.

5:11 am: Plow hit fence on Grove Avenue. Driver will contact resident in the morning.

6:35 am: Train derailment.

6:54 am: plow hit vehicle on Main Street, airbags deployed.

9:39 am: Business manager on Fordham Road reporting former employee refusing to leave. Subject advised he is no longer welcome and subject to arrest.

10:20 am: Two-car accident on Main Street, no injuries.

10:26 am: Possible house fire on Lake Street. Road is clear.

11:27 am: Harassing phone calls from unknown caller.

2:29 pm: Kids throwing snowballs at cars on Shawsheen Avenue at Aldrich Road.

3:02 pm: FedEX driver dropped off found wallet.

5:08 pm: Parties smoking marijuana in car at Speedway on Main Street. Gone on arrival.

5:21 pm: CVS employee reports angry customer made threats, grabbed her wrist. Party left, will try to make contact at residence.

7:14 pm: Two car crash at Wilmington Builder's Supply on Main Street. Operator of white pickup yelling at other party.
